What Exactly Is Waterboy and Firegirl?

At its core, Waterboy and Firegirl is a physics-based puzzle platformer where you control two characters with opposing elemental powers. You switch between them to solve environmental puzzles. Waterboy can extinguish fires and walk through water safely, while Firegirl melts ice blocks and walks through lava unharmed. But here's the catch:

Warning: Make Waterboy touch lava and he'll turn to steam. Let Firegirl fall in water? Poof - instant cloud of disappointment. Took me three tries on level 3 to remember that.

The game progression follows this pattern:

  • Early levels teach basic mechanics (seriously, don't skip these)
  • Mid-game introduces timed switches and moving platforms
  • Late-game becomes brutally complex with conveyor belts and disappearing blocks

Core Game Mechanics Explained Simply

Character Switching

Press SPACE (PC) or tap the icon (mobile) to swap characters. The inactive character freezes in place. Pro tip: Always position the inactive character somewhere safe first - learned this after poor Waterboy got crushed by a falling block while I was controlling Firegirl.

Environmental Interactions

  • 🔥 Fire pits: Deadly to Waterboy, safe for Firegirl
  • 💧 Water pools: Kill Firegirl instantly, heal Waterboy
  • ❄️ Ice blocks: Only Firegirl can destroy these
  • 🪨 Rock barriers: Require coordinated actions to break
  • ⚡️ Electric fields: Kill both characters equally

Essential Strategies That Actually Work

After failing level 17 about eleven times, I developed these practical approaches:

Path Priority Method: Always move the character with the most obstacles first. If Waterboy's path has three fire pits but Firegirl only has one ice block? Move Waterboy first.

Switch Timing Technique: For moving platforms, time your character switch mid-jump. The frozen character maintains momentum. Tricky but game-changing once mastered.

Sacrificial Positioning: Sometimes you need to leave one character in a "safe danger" spot temporarily. Example: Firegirl can stand near (but not in) water while Waterboy clears a path.

Advanced Tactics for Later Levels

Around level 30, things get wild:

  • Use conveyor belts to "store" one character off-screen
  • Trigger switches with well-timed elemental touches
  • Master the "double jump" by switching mid-air

Common Problems and Fixes

Game not loading? Clear browser cache or try Chrome instead of Safari. Mobile version crashing? Check for updates - version 2.1 fixed most stability issues.

Control Issues

On touchscreens, enable "fixed joystick" in settings. For PC, I recommend these key bindings:

  • Move: Arrow keys (more precise than WASD)
  • Jump: Z key (easier to press while moving)
  • Switch: Spacebar (keep thumb ready)

Frequently Asked Questions

How many levels does Waterboy and Firegirl have?

The main campaign has 45 levels but there's an expert mode with 30 additional brutal puzzles. I've only cleared 12 expert levels - they're seriously challenging.

Can I play Waterboy and Firegirl offline?

Only the paid mobile and PC versions offer offline play. Browser versions require internet.

Is there a Waterboy and Firegirl 2?

Not yet, but the developers hinted at a sequel with co-op mode. Wouldn't that be awesome? Controlling characters simultaneously with a friend.

Why can't I beat level 19?

Ah, the dual elevator stage. Common mistake: players try moving both characters together. Solution: Move one character completely through their path before even touching the other. Waterboy first, then Firegirl.
